Responsibilities:
  • Providing individualized instruction and support to students with blindness or visual impairments
  • Assessing students' needs and developing appropriate learning materials and mobility plans
  • Teaching orientation and mobility skills, including safe and independent travel techniques
  • Adapting classroom and school environments to ensure accessibility for students
  • Preparing students with visual impairments to travel independently and safely
  • Performing evaluations focused on both long- and short-term mobility needs
  • Developing instruction tailored to students’ assessed needs, IEP goals and objectives, functioning level, and motivation
  • Preparing and using specialized equipment and materials such as tactile maps, models, optical devices, pre-canes, and GPS devices
  • Instructing students in recreational and leisure skills, outdoor travel, and use of residential and public transportation
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ree in teaching for the Visually Impaired and/or Orientation and Mobility
  • PA Orientation and Mobility Specialist certificate
